Global oil prices witnessed a surge during the recovery period after COVID-related lockdowns. It ros...
Category : Economics
Four weeks have passed since Russia began its military invasion of Ukraine. Over the last few months...
‘Hanging up a sheep’s head but selling dog meat’ The aforementioned is an ancient Chinese...
A foreign direct investment is a business transaction that involves acquiring a significant stake in...
The outbreak of COVID-19 exposed the over-reliance of Japanese companies upon China's manufacturing ...